The Nectar mattress is an all-foam bed with an 11″ profile. It utilizes a quilted cover, overtop layers of gel-infused memory foam, support memory foam, and high-density poly foam to develop a gentle ambiance full of sinkage and pressure relief. To get a much better understanding of how these products work together, let’s dive into the layers! The Nectar kicks off with a cover quilted with a little memory foam.
Getting an up close look at the Nectar Constructed with gel-infused memory foam, the convenience layer has a very. As you extend on the bed, you’ll likely feel yourself sinking deeply into this top layer, with the product contouring to your body for pressure relief at the shoulders and hips.
Up next you’ll find a transitional layer of memory foam, which has a slightly quicker response to pressure than the foam above it. This section is implied to alleviate the sleeper into the firmer base listed below,. And lastly, we land on a layer of high-density poly foam. This dense product offers the bed with its, working to support the softer convenience and shift layers.

Below, I’m going to size up the Nectar against the Purple and Casper bed mattress. The Purple mattress is built with hyper-elastic polymer over high-density poly foam for a. While both beds are technically “all-foam,” the special polymer material in the Purple (a quasi-rubbery, collapsible grid) makes for a much livelier structure.
Unlike with the Nectar, there’s not a great deal of sinkage here, so folks ought to feel more “on the top” of the bed than “in” it. Pricewise, the Purple is more expensive than the Nectar. The Casper mattress is better in feel to the Nectar than the Purple. However, it differs the previous by placing its memory foam leading layer over a layer of latex-like alternative foam, instead of another layer of memory foam.

We found that the Nectar had a distinct smell for a few days after unpacking, however ultimately dissipated and wasn’t an issue after the preliminary couple of days.

For a bit more description, off-gassing often happens with newer bed mattress because unpacking them releases volatile natural substances (VOCs) into the air. VOCs are fairly safe but they bring an unique odor that numerous compare to plastic or rubber. Body conforming is an essential strength of the Nectar Mattress (). Our screening discovered that the two memory foam convenience layers absorb and cradle the body, conforming uniformly to different locations and equally distributing weight throughout the surface.
Those who enjoy that feeling will discover the Nectar Mattress comfy and supportive. On the other hand, individuals who prefer sleeping on– not in– a mattress may not be as pleased with the bed. Our internal and external screening found that the Nectar mattress traps some heat throughout a night of sleep.
Nectar has both medium- and low-density foams in its convenience layers, making it a slightly cooler alternative than other memory foam rivals on the market. The Nectar does utilize more breathable materials in its cover, TENCEL ” lyocell and cotton – . These materials provide much better breathability than other common cover products, such as polyester or rayon.
